The Epson Pro EX9270 is a strong contender for anyone looking for a budget-friendly micro-projector primarily for business or educational settings. It offers full HD 1080p resolution, which ensures sharp and clear images suitable for presentations, videos, and spreadsheets. The brightness level of 4,100 lumens is impressive for this category, allowing the projector to perform well even in well-lit rooms, making it easier to share content with larger groups without needing to dim the lights. Its contrast ratio of up to 16,000:1 enhances details in images and graphs, providing richer visuals.
Connectivity is versatile with two HDMI ports, a USB port that can power streaming devices, and built-in Wi-Fi supporting Apple AirPlay and Miracast for wireless streaming from various devices. This flexibility makes it convenient to connect laptops, smartphones, and popular streaming sticks. The built-in 16-watt speaker is a nice bonus, delivering clear sound that suits small to medium-sized rooms without needing extra audio equipment.
This projector is not battery-powered, so it requires a power outlet, which might limit portability compared to some micro-projectors with built-in batteries. At nearly 7 pounds and dimensions over a foot wide, it's more portable than a traditional projector but not ultra-lightweight. The setup is relatively easy with optical zoom and automatic vertical keystone correction to help achieve a squared image quickly. It excels in bright, clear image projection and connectivity features for those needing a reliable device in classrooms or meeting rooms. If you prioritize portability and battery operation for outdoor or mobile use, this might not be the best fit. But for a budget micro-projector focused on performance and ease of use indoors, it stands out as a solid choice.
The Epson Pro EX11000 is a solid choice for those needing a bright, clear projector on a budget, especially for business or presentation use. It offers a crisp Full HD 1080p resolution, which means you get detailed and sharp images suitable for videos and detailed content like spreadsheets. Its standout feature is the impressive brightness at 4,600 lumens, making it easy to see in rooms with ambient light, unlike many budget projectors that struggle in well-lit spaces. The contrast ratio is very high at 100,000:1, which helps with richer colors and clearer details, improving the image quality.
Connectivity is versatile with two HDMI ports, Ethernet, Wi-Fi, and support for Miracast screen mirroring. This means you can easily connect laptops, streaming devices, or mirror your phone screen without hassle. The built-in 16W speaker is above average for a projector speaker, so you won’t immediately need external speakers for most meetings or casual videos. The projector requires a power outlet, which limits portability compared to battery-powered micro-projectors.
In terms of size and weight, it’s relatively compact and light at 9.5 pounds and about a foot wide, making it easy to move from room to room, though it’s not pocket-sized. The laser light source is a big plus for longevity and low maintenance since it lasts about 20,000 hours without needing bulb replacements. This projector is ideal for users who want a bright, reliable projector for business presentations or home media viewing in moderate to well-lit environments. If you need something truly portable with battery power or ultra-compact size, this might not be the best fit. However, for image quality, brightness, and connectivity at this price point, it performs very well.
